How to enhance breathability and reduce skin stuffiness during prolonged wear of a sports two-color silicone strap?

Publish Time: 2026-06-08
With the widespread use of smartwatches in running, cycling, hiking, fitness, and outdoor adventures, users have increasingly higher demands for strap comfort. Sports two-color silicone straps, with their soft, skin-friendly texture, rich colors, water and sweat resistance, and durability, have become a mainstream feature of many sports watches. However, during prolonged wear, the wrist continuously generates heat and sweat. If the strap's breathability is insufficient, it can easily lead to localized stuffiness, dampness, and even skin discomfort.

1. Enhancing Wearing Comfort with Skin-Friendly and Environmentally Friendly Silicone

Material performance is a crucial factor affecting the wearing experience. High-quality sports two-color silicone straps are typically made of skin-friendly and environmentally friendly silicone, which has superior softness and elasticity compared to ordinary materials. This allows it to better conform to the wrist's curves and reduce localized pressure. At the same time, high-quality silicone has excellent breathability and low skin irritation, maintaining a comfortable and natural wearing experience even during prolonged skin contact. Compared to rigid materials, soft silicone also reduces discomfort caused by friction, improving overall comfort.

2. Optimized Ventilation Structure Enhances Airflow

To improve air circulation during wear, many sports two-color silicone straps incorporate a vent design. By evenly distributing ventilation holes or channels on the strap surface, airflow is effectively increased, allowing heat and moisture to escape more easily. Especially during exercise, these vents facilitate air exchange between the wrist and the outside air, reducing sweat buildup. A well-designed vent size and spacing not only ensures structural strength but also significantly improves heat dissipation and wearing comfort.

3. Enhanced Design Flexibility Through Two-Color Injection Molding

Two-color injection molding is a key feature of sports two-color silicone straps. This process allows for the precise combination of materials with different hardness and properties, enabling richer structural designs. For example, soft, breathable materials can be used in areas in contact with the skin, while stronger materials can be used in support areas, balancing comfort and durability. Simultaneously, the two-color structure creates unique air channels and a three-dimensional texture, helping to reduce the area of contact between the strap and the skin and improving airflow efficiency.

4. Enhanced Surface Texture Design Reduces Skin Contact Area

Besides the design of ventilation holes, the texture of the watch strap surface also affects heat dissipation. Modern sports two-color silicone straps typically use wave, honeycomb, or raised texture designs to create a micro-air layer between the strap and the skin. Due to the reduced contact area, air flows more easily within the strap, carrying away heat and moisture. This design not only reduces stuffiness but also minimizes discomfort caused by prolonged sweat retention, improving comfort during extended wear.

5. Improved Sweat-wicking Capacity for Dryness

During high-intensity activities such as running and fitness, sweat production increases significantly. If sweat cannot evaporate quickly, the wrist area can become damp and stuffy. Therefore, sports two-color silicone straps need excellent sweat-wicking properties. Optimized drainage channels and ventilation layout allow sweat to evaporate quickly. Simultaneously, the silicone material itself is waterproof and does not easily absorb sweat and dirt, helping to keep the strap surface clean and dry, improving wearing comfort.

6. Enhanced Weather Resistance for Long-Term Comfort

Sports watch straps are frequently exposed to sunlight, rain, and challenging outdoor environments, making their long-term performance crucial. UV-modified treatment effectively improves the strap's UV resistance, reducing aging, hardening, and deformation caused by sun exposure. Maintaining good softness and elasticity helps preserve breathability and comfort over time, ensuring a stable wearing experience for users in various sports environments.

In conclusion, sports two-color silicone strap enhancing breathability and reducing skin stuffiness during extended wear requires comprehensive improvements in multiple aspects, including the selection of skin-friendly and environmentally friendly silicone materials, optimized pore structure, application of two-color injection molding, surface texture design, improved sweat-wicking capacity, and enhanced weather resistance.
